HBO Finalizes Plans to Wrap Up ‘Treme’

Oct 29, 2012  •  Post A Comment

HBO unveiled how extensive its production plans are for its New Orleans-based drama series “Treme,” which is approaching its endgame, Deadline.com reports. The pay-cable network will begin production Nov. 5 on an abbreviated final season.

The final season — the series’ fourth — will consist of just five episodes, the story reports. HBO confirmed that the five-episode order will end the series’ run.

The story adds: “’Treme’ co-creator David Simon told a New Orleans crowd last month that ‘we are going to be back for a season 3.5. HBO, upon viewing the 10 (episodes from Season 3) that we gave them and what we’ve done, they want to see the end of the story. They fought very hard to give us half a loaf. We’re going to take it and run.’”
